Paver Driveway Construction in Denver, CO
Paver driveway construction involves installing durable and visually appealing paved surfaces for resid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including creating new driveways, replacing existing ones, or expanding current paved areas. Homeowners typically seek information on the types of materials available, such as concrete, brick, or stone pavers, and want to understand how these choices affect the driveway’s appearance and longevity. Additionally, property owners often inquire about the preparation process, including site grading and base installation, to ensure the driveway will withstand daily use and weather conditions.
Before requesting paver driveway construction, property owners should consider factors such as the desired driveway size, style preferences, and budget. It's also helpful to understand maintenance requirements and how different paving options complement the overall look of the property. Clarifying the scope of work, including any necessary site preparation or drainage considerations, can lead to a smoother project process. Gathering this information ensures that the finished driveway aligns with both aesthetic goals and functional needs.

Paver Driveway Construction Questions
What types of materials are used for paver driveways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, offering durability and aesthetic options for driveways.
Are paver driveways suitable for all types of properties? Paver driveways can enhance a variety of properties, including residential and commercial, providing a customizable surface.
What maintenance is required for a paver driveway? Regular cleaning and occasional resealing help maintain the appearance and longevity of paver driveways.
Can paver driveways be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, pavers can often be installed over existing concrete or asphalt, depending on the condition of the current surface.
